  • Abstract
    In this paper, stabilization and synchronization control problems are considered for Markovian jumping neural networks with mode-dependent mixed time delays subject to quantization and packet dropout. By using the novel Lyapunov–Krasovskii functional, stochastic analysis technology and quantization feedback method, the stabilization problem is solved for the addressed neural networks firstly. Also, it is assumed that system state is quantized before being communicated. Then the sufficient condition for the existence of an admissible controller is established to ensure the asymptotic synchronization of the resulting closed-loop coupled neural networks. Finally, two numerical examples are presented to show the validity of our theoretical analysis results.
